BITS was ranked as one of the top four best B schools in India. It has a very high reputation among Indian Universities. SO this was reason enough for me to pursue MBA at BITS. The eligibility for the course was B.Tech/ B. E or masters in any disciplines. CAT/GMAT scores were used for shortlisting. The registration cost was 2750 rupees.

Course Curriculum Overview :

MBA at BITS is a 2 year on campus program. The course is divided into three semesters, and gave us an exposure to the industry through a six month internship. The faculty at our university was highly qualified and have doctoral degrees. They were also very supportive and helped us through each and every step of the course. The faculty student ratio is 10:1. The syllabus gave importance to experimental learning.

Placement Experience :

Adithya Birla Group, Adobe, Amazon are among the major recruiters. The campus placements are organized by the placement cell. We were given classes and advices on how to prepare for the placements. The placement percentage at BITS was around 90%. And the highest CTC offered was 25 LAP and the average was 7 lpa .

Fee Structure And Facilities :

MBA students at BITS are given opportunities as teaching assistants. The students selected are given a chance to work with the teachers. This can be considered as a campus job, and this is paid. They also provide scholarships based on the academic performance of the students. And this scholarship includes fee waiver.

Campus Life :

BITS has highly advanced infrastructure. The motto of our institution is to provide the students with the best education possible. So we had everything from library, computer lab, gym and reading/study rooms. Many events and competitions were also conducted. The engineering departments also conduct tech fests occasionally.

Hostel Facilities :

Both hostel facilities and PG facilities are available. I would say that Hostels are much cheaper because the rooms are shared. The rooms are all well-furnished. The registration is conducted during the course admission. We also had a mess and cafeteria. Both provided good quality food.
